There are a couple of requirements before one is granted a certification and permitted to graduate from phlebotomy training.

Many young people select medical training programs in phlebotomy, as becoming a phlebotomy lab technician is an excellent beginning of your career in a healthcare area. You must go through the training program and pass it. Later, you are to take the examination granted by a recognized certification agency.

In addition to the NPA, agencies that certify phlebotomy candidates include the American Credentialing Agency, the American Society for Clinical Pathologies Board of Certification, American Medical Technologists, the National Center for Proficiency Testing, as well as the National Healthcareer Association. On-the-job phlebotomy training in Chula Vista California comprises supervised practical experience drawing blood, disposing of biohazardous substances, and basic laboratory processes. Hands on phlebotomy training is, in addition, intensely safety-focused, since workers risk regular exposure to blood-borne illnesses--including Hepatitis and HIV. These instruments include various sized syringes, biohazardous-spill kits, tourniquets, dermal puncture devices, blood culture bottles, locking arm rests, bandages and tape.
